JACE MARINO

I just wanted to go home. But Marco had called earlier, saying we were meeting at the club. He and Mateo were already there. The night club wasn't exactly a safe haven, but it was one of the few legal faces of the family business. At least on paper. To everyone else, it was just music, drinks and rich men pretending they're not sinners.

When I got there the bass was loud enough to make the floor shake. I found my brothers in the back office going through papers and receipts. Marco was sitting with his legs up on the desk smoking. Mateo was focused on the ledger tapping a pen against his teeth like he wanted to stab it into someone.

"Finally," Marco said when I walked in. "You look like shit."

"Good to see you too," I said, closing the door. I sat down beside Mateo glancing over the papers. "What's this?"

"Expenses," he said, "and some idiot who thinks he can get free nights at our club."
